In the past week, Kathy’s kaiawhina have been doing science with Talei.

We have been learning about ecosystems! We even got to make our own, (as you can see in the pictures.) There needs to be a consumer, a producer and a decomposer.

Consumer: a consumer is something that eats other things. E.g an animal or insect.

Producer: a producer is like an apple tree, it makes its own food instead of finding or hunting it.

Decomposer: a decomposer is something that breaks down something like Fungi or worms.

The equipment I used were;
A clear container
Something that can poke holes through the lid (I used a drill, be sure to ask an adult to help )
Stones
Soil (use gloves when handling soil)
Seeds or a plant
Snails
Worms
Food and water for the snails and worms

Marble Run

Marble Run 

Today Kathy's kaiawhina did a challenge with Nicole (or Miss J.) we had to make a marble run out of; 6 pieces of newsprint, 2 sheets of A4  paper and 2 meters of cellar-tape. It had to stand on its own (without the help of any furniture) and roll at least 3 meters.

It took us about 1/2 an hour to make and in the end it was worth it. There were a few muck ups but we did really well in the race with nearly 5 meters! 

next time I would make the whole structure stronger and make the second tube wider instead of it fitting inside the first one making the marble get stuck in the middle. other than that I wouldn't change anything!
